Download as PDF Federal Register / Vol. 77, No. 113 / Tuesday, June 12, 2012 / Notices srobinson on DSK4SPTVN1PROD with NOTICES S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Discussion Notice is hereby given that the NRC has issued renewed facility operating license No. DPR–35 to Entergy Operations Inc., the operator of the PNPS. Renewed facility operating license No. DPR–35 authorizes operation of PNPS by the licensee at reactor core power levels not in excess of 2,028 megawatts thermal in accordance with the provisions of the PNPS renewed license and its technical specifications. The notice also serves as the record of decision for the renewal of facility operating license No. DPR–35, consistent with Title 10 of the Code of Federal Regulations (10 CFR) 51.103. As discussed in the final supplemental environmental impact statement (FSEIS) for PNPS, Supplement 47 to NUREG– 1437, ‘‘Generic Environmental Impact Statement for License Renewal of Nuclear Plants Regarding Pilgrim Nuclear Power Station,’’ dated July 2007 (ADAMS Accession Nos. ML071990020 and ML071990027), the Commission has considered a range of reasonable alternatives that included fossil fuel generation, renewable energy sources, demand-side measures such as energy conservation, and the no-action alternative. The factors considered in the record of decision can be found in the FSEIS for PNPS. PNPS is a boiling water reactor located 4 miles southeast of Plymouth, Massachusetts. The application for the renewed license, ‘‘Pilgrim Nuclear Power Station License Renewal Application,’’ dated January 25, 2006 (ADAMS Accession No. ML060300028), complied with the standards and requirements of the Atomic Energy Act of 1954, as amended (the Act), and the Commission’s regulations. As required by the Act and the Commission’s regulations in 10 CFR Chapter 1, the Commission has made appropriate findings, which are set forth in the license. Prior public notice of the action involving the proposed issuance of the renewed license and of an opportunity for a hearing regarding the proposed issuance of the renewed license was published in the Federal Register on March 27, 2006 (71 FR 15222). [FR Doc. 2012–14262 Filed 6–11–12; 8:45 am] BILLING CODE 7590–01–P NUCLEAR REGULATORY COMMISSION Advisory Committee on Reactor Safeguards (ACRS); Meeting of the ACRS Subcommittee on Power Uprates; Notice of Meeting The ACRS Subcommittee on Power Uprates will hold a meeting on June 22, 2012, Room T–2B1, 11545 Rockville Pike, Rockville, Maryland. The meeting will be open to public attendance, with the exception of portions that may be closed to protect information that is proprietary pursuant to 5 U.S.C. 552b(c)(4). The agenda for the subject meeting shall be as follows: Friday, June 22, 2012—8:30 a.m. Until 5:00 p.m. The Subcommittee will review the Safety Evaluation (SER) associated with the St. Lucie 2 extended power uprate application. The Subcommittee will hear presentations by and hold discussions with the NRC staff, Florida Power and Light Company, and other interested persons regarding this matter. The Subcommittee will gather information, analyze relevant issues and facts, and formulate proposed positions and actions, as appropriate, for deliberation by the Full Committee. ACTION: Notice of an application for an order under section 6(c) of the Investment Company Act of 1940 (‘‘Act’’) for an exemption from sections 2(a)(32), 5(a)(1), 22(d) and 22(e) of the Act and rule 22c–1 under the Act, under sections 6(c) and 17(b) of the Act for an exemption from sections 17(a)(1) and (a)(2) of the Act, and under section 12(d)(1)(J) of the Act for an exemption from sections 12(d)(1)(A) and (B) of the Act. AGENCY: Arrow Investment Advisers, LLC (‘‘Arrow’’) and Arrow Investments Trust (the ‘‘Trust’’). SUMMARY OF APPLICATION: Applicants request an order that permits: (a) Actively-managed series of certain open-end management investment companies to issue shares (‘‘Shares’’) redeemable in large aggregations only (‘‘Creation Units’’); (b) secondary market transactions in Shares to occur at negotiated market prices; (c) certain series to pay redemption proceeds, under certain circumstances, more than seven days from the tender of Shares for redemption; (d) certain affiliated persons of the series to deposit securities into, and receive securities from, the series in connection with the purchase and redemption of Creation Units; and (e) certain registered management investment companies and unit investment trusts outside of the same group of investment companies as the series to acquire Shares. Applicants’ Representations 1. The Trust will be registered as an open-end management investment company under the Act and is a statutory trust organized under the laws of Delaware. The Trust will initially offer an actively-managed investment series, Arrow Global Tactical Yield ETF (the ‘‘Initial Fund’’). The investment objective of the Initial Fund will be to seek to preserve and grow capital, independent of market direction. 2. Arrow, a Delaware limited liability company, will serve as investment adviser to the Initial Fund. Each Advisor (as defined below) is or will be is registered as an investment adviser under the Investment Advisers Act of 1940 (‘‘Advisers Act’’). The Advisor may in the future retain one or more subadvisers (‘‘Subadvisors’’) to manage the portfolio of Funds (as defined below). Any Subadvisor will be registered under the Advisers Act. A registered broker-dealer under the Securities Exchange Act of 1934 (‘‘Exchange Act’’), which may be an affiliate of the Advisor, will act as the distributor and principal underwriter of the Funds (‘‘Distributor’’). 3.
